The Gumnut is the lifeblood of the Australian Eucalyptus, a tiny powerhouse of regeneration that thrives in the face of harsh conditions and fire. As many eucalypt species have evolved to depend on bushfires for renewal, the Gumnut endures, survives, and flourishes, ensuring the continued legacy of Australia’s towering gum forests.
Beyond its remarkable resilience, the Gumnut has been woven into Australian folklore, made famous in May Gibbs' beloved ‘Snugglepot and Cuddlepie’ stories, a bedtime staple for generations of Aussie kids.
